1.音视频无法自动播放的问题
<script>
function audioAutoPlay(id) {var audio = ElementById(id),play = function () {audio.play();veEventListener("touchstart", play, false);};audio.play();document.addEventListener("WeixinJSBridgeReady", function () {//微信play();}, false);document.addEventListener('YixinJSBridgeReady', function () {//易信play();}, false);document.addEventListener("touchstart", play, false);}audioAutoPlay('bg');
</script>2. WOW.js不能用,会出现底部留白的问题,可以用scrollrevealJs替代,完美解决3. 视频设置不要控制器的参数
<video src="./video/movie.mp4?v=1.04" onclick="playPause()"poster='./images/1566017156(1).jpg?v=1.04' id="video01" preload="auto"webkit-playsinline="true" playsinline="true" x-webkit-airplay="allow"x5-video-player-type="h5" x5-video-player-fullscreen="true" x5-video-orientation="portraint"style="object-fit:fill">您的浏览器不支持 video 播放。
</video>4.判断是苹果机还是安卓机
<script>var u = navigator.userAgent, app = navigator.appVersion;var isAndroid = u.indexOf('Android') > -1 || u.indexOf('Linux') > -1; //gvar isIOS = !!u.match(/(i[^;]+;( U;)? CPU.+Mac OS X/); //ios终端if (isAndroid) {}if (isIOS) {}
</script>5.滚动条距离顶部多长,然后再滑动执行的方法;不能用
原因应该是微信自带的下滑出现该网站由提供,导致的滑动冲突问题6. 关于css的这个css3样式,可以写链式样式,但是我这边亲测,写在<style>里,苹果机会出现无法使用的问题
animation-delay: 0 !important;7.视频的版本号小数点不能超过2位数,不然在苹果机会出现播放不了的情况,安卓机亲测是可以的,也可能是缓存问题,但最好还是不要超过两位数,保证随时可以播放的状态
本文发布于:2024-02-04 07:08:27,感谢您对本站的认可!
本文链接:https://www.4u4v.net/it/170701791053462.html
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。
留言与评论(共有 0 条评论) |